Ultrasound probes are testing systems that can be used for non-destructive testing of mechanical structures such as tubes, plates, and bars. In general, ultrasound probes operate by generating acoustic signals and detecting acoustic signals reflected from the test structure. Analysis of the reflected acoustic signals can yield information about the test structure, such as the presence of flaws and dimensions.
To ensure proper operation of a given ultrasound probe, probe specific information issued by a manufacturer can be referenced by an operator during use. However, this information can be lost or separated from its corresponding ultrasonic probe, potentially incurring delays during its retrieval from a manufacturer.
In general, systems and methods are provided for communication with testing systems, such as ultrasound probes.
In one embodiment, a testing system is provided and can include a sensor and a radiofrequency (RF) tag mounted on the sensor. The RF tag can be configured to store sensor information and to wirelessly transmit at least a portion of the sensor information in response to receipt of a request for sensor information.
The RF tag can have a variety of configurations. In one embodiment, the RF tag can be configured to receive sensor information from the sensor for storage. Sensor information received from the sensor can include an operating time of the sensor. In another embodiment, the RF tag can be configured to receive sensor information for storage from a data source external to the testing system. Sensor information received from a data source external to the testing system can include, for example, a unique identifier of the sensor, a sensor certificate, a sensor datasheet, a calibration due date for the sensor, and/or test orders for the sensor.
In another embodiment, the transmitted sensor information can be a link to a network resource storing at least one of a unique identifier of the sensor, a sensor certificate, a sensor datasheet, a calibration due date for the sensor, test orders for the sensor, and/or an operating time of the sensor.
In other aspects, an ultrasound testing system is provided and can include an ultrasound probe and a radiofrequency (RF) tag. The RF tag can be configured to store probe information regarding the ultrasound probe and to wirelessly transmit at least a portion of the probe information in response to receipt of a near-field communication from an authorized source.
The RF tag can have a variety of configurations. In one embodiment, the RF tag can be configured for passive operation. In another embodiment, the RF tag can be mounted to a housing of the ultrasound probe. In another embodiment, the RF tag can be configured for read-only storage of at least a portion of the probe information.
In another embodiment, the RF tag can be configured to receive probe information from the ultrasonic probe for storage. The probe information received from the ultrasonic probe can include, for example, an operating time of the ultrasound probe.
In another embodiment, the authorized near-field communication can be received from a portable computing device. The probe information can include at least one of a unique identifier of the ultrasound probe, an ultrasound probe certificate, an ultrasound probe datasheet, a calibration due date for the ultrasound probe, and/or test orders for the ultrasound probe.
Methods for communicating with an ultrasound testing system are also provided. In one embodiment, a method can include causing a portable computing device to transmit a first near-field communication to a radiofrequency (RF) tag that can store probe information regarding an ultrasound probe, where the first near-field communication can request at least a portion of probe information stored by the RF tag and where the portable computing device receives a second near-field communication that can include at least a portion of the requested probe information.
In another embodiment, the probe information can include at least one of a unique identifier of the sensor, a sensor certificate, a sensor datasheet, a calibration due date for the sensor, test orders for the sensor, and/or an operating time of the sensor.
In another embodiment, the probe information can include an operating time of the ultrasound probe.
In another embodiment, the requested probe information can include a link to a network resource storing at least one of a unique identifier of the sensor, an ultrasound probe certificate, an ultrasound probe datasheet, a calibration due date for the ultrasound probe, test orders for the ultrasound probe, and/or an operating time of the ultrasound probe.
In other aspects, the method can include causing the portable computing device to transmit a third communication to the network resource requesting the probe information corresponding to the link. The portable computing device can receive a fourth communication that includes the probe information corresponding to the link.
In another embodiment, the RF tag can be mounted to the ultrasonic probe.
These and other features will be more readily understood from the following detailed description taken in conjunction with the accompanying drawings, in which:
It is noted that the drawings are not necessarily to scale. The drawings are intended to depict only typical aspects of the subject matter disclosed herein, and therefore should not be considered as limiting the scope of the disclosure.
Certain exemplary embodiments will now be described to provide an overall understanding of the principles of the structure, function, manufacture, and use of the systems, devices, and methods disclosed herein. One or more examples of these embodiments are illustrated in the accompanying drawings. Those skilled in the art will understand that the systems, devices, and methods specifically described herein and illustrated in the accompanying drawings are non-limiting exemplary embodiments and that the scope of the present invention is defined solely by the claims. The features illustrated or described in connection with one exemplary embodiment may be combined with the features of other embodiments. Such modifications and variations are intended to be included within the scope of the present invention. Further, in the present disclosure, like-named components of the embodiments generally have similar features, and thus within a particular embodiment each feature of each like-named component is not necessarily fully elaborated upon.
Manufacturers of testing systems, such as ultrasound probes, can provide customers with a variety of information for use during operation and maintenance of their testing system. This information can detail capabilities of the testing system and maintenance schedules, among others, and can be specific to a given testing system. However, this information is commonly issued in paper form and can be easily lost after purchase of the sensor. In some instances, when information for a testing system is lost, use of the testing system can be delayed while an owner or operator of the testing system identifies the specific testing system and contacts the manufacturer to obtain duplicate copies of the information. Accordingly, a testing system is provided that enables sensor information to be electronically stored and wirelessly communicated to a user upon request. Other embodiments are within the scope of the disclosed subject matter.
Embodiments of testing systems are discussed herein with reference to ultrasonic probes. However, embodiments of the disclosure can be employed with any testing system without limit, such as X-ray, computed tomography (CT), magnetic resonance imaging (MRI), eddy current, and nuclear inspection systems.
The housing 202 can have any shape and can be formed from any material suitable for housing the sensing element(s) 206. The sensor 200 can be an ultrasonic sensor and the sensing element(s) 206 can be one or more of ultrasonic transmitters, ultrasonic receivers, ultrasonic transducers, and combinations thereof.
The sensor interface 208, schematically shown in
The sensor 200 can also include one or more memory devices (not shown) for storing measurements acquired by the sensor 200 (e.g., by the sensing elements 206 and/or the counter 214). As discussed in greater detail below, the sensor interface 208 can also be configured to communicate with the RF tag 110 for storing sensor information.
The antenna 302 can include loops or coils of conductive metal wire in electrical communication with the microchip 304, and it can be configured for receipt and transmission RF waves. As an example, the antenna 302 can be configured to receive and transmit RF waves having frequencies ranging between about 300 MHz to about 300 GHz. In certain embodiments, the antenna 302 can be configured to receive and transmit RF waves at frequencies less than about 1 GHz, which can allow penetration through most objects to facilitate communication with devices lacking line of sight with the RF tag 110. These frequency ranges are merely exemplary, and other frequencies can be used e.g., about 1 Hz to about 1 THz.
The microchip 304 can be an integrated circuit including a processor and a non-volatile memory (not shown) configured to store sensor information. The microchip memory can be a read only memory device, a read-write memory device, and combinations thereof. RF waves received by the antenna 302 can contain commands for storage of sensor information by the microchip memory or transmission of sensor information stored by the microchip memory. Accordingly, the microchip processor can also be configured to process these commands.
In certain embodiments, the microchip 304 can be configured to only process commands received from an authorized source. As an example, the microchip 304 can employ one or more authentication protocols to verify whether a given communication received by the RF tag 110 is from an authorized source.
Embodiments of the RF tag 110 can be configured to operate passively. In this configuration, the RF tag 110 can transmit sensor information only in response to requests from authorized sources. As an example, electrical currents can be induced within the antenna 302 upon receipt of RF waves. At least a portion of this current can be employed to power operation of the microchip 304 and transmission of RF waves by the antenna 302. Accordingly, embodiments of the RF tag 110 can omit an internal power source. However, alternative embodiments of the RF tag can be configured to operate actively and transmit sensor information or other information absent requests from authorized sources. Embodiments of the RF tag configured for active operation can also include a power source (not shown) electrically coupled to the microchip and the antenna, such as a battery.
Embodiments of the RF tag 110 can also transmit RF waves according to any of a variety of wireless communication protocols. Examples of wireless communication protocols can include, but are not limited to, radiofrequency identification (RFID), near field communication (NFC), Wi-Fi®, and Bluetooth®.
Examples of sensor information can include one or more of the following, in any combination:
The sensor information can be transmitted to the RF tag 110 for storage in a variety of forms. As an example, one or more of the sensor specific information can be stored in its entirety by the RF tag 110. In another embodiment, one or more of the sensor specific information can be stored in a summarized form that occupies less memory storage than its entirety. As another example, one or more of the sensor information can be stored as a link (e.g., a hyperlink). The link can specify a network resource (e.g., a website, a database, etc.) from which the portable computing device 104 can retrieve the corresponding sensor information in its entirety and/or in summarized form. The network resource can be any of the external sources 112 discussed herein. This link can occupy less memory storage than either the entirety of the sensor information or the sensor information in summarized form. As another example, each of the sensor information can be stored as any combination of the above.
In certain embodiments, one or more of the sensor information can be provided to the RF tag 110 for storage prior to sale or use of the sensor 106 in the field. As an example, manufacturers can store unique identifiers, certificates, datasheets, and sensor setups on the RF tag 110 prior to sale of the sensor 106. As another example, owners or operators can store test orders and calibration due dates on the RF tag 110 prior to use of the sensor 106 in the field. As another example, an owner or operator of the sensor can employ the sensor interface 208 to store an operating time of the sensor 106 on the RF tag 110 during and/or after use of the sensor 106 in the field. As another example, sensor operators can employ the portable computing device 104 to update a sensor information stored by the RF tag before, during, or after use of the sensor 106 in the field.
As shown in
In certain embodiments, the RF tag 110 can store more than one document for a given type of sensor information. As an example, sensor setup information can be stored by the RF tag 110 in multiple documents, each of which can be suitable for use under different testing conditions (e.g., materials, testing environments, etc.). Under this circumstance, the portable computing device 104 can provide a selectable list of sensor information options (e.g., user interface objects 406) for each of the multiple documents stored by the RF tag 110.
In operation 604, the portable computing device 104 can transmit a first communication to the RF tag 110 requesting at least a portion of the sensor information stored by the RF tag 110. In an embodiment, the first communication can be a near field communication requesting sensor information corresponding to the option(s) selected by an operator in operation 602.
In operation 606, the portable computing device 104 can receive a second communication from the RF tag 110 in response to the first communication. The second communication can be a near field communication including one or more of the requested sensor information. As an example, the RF tag 110 can conduct a search of its memory and return any stored sensor information corresponding to the requested sensor information in the second communication.
In operation 610, any of the requested sensor information contained within the second communication can be displayed and/or optionally stored by the portable computing device 104.
In an embodiment, the second communication can include one or more of the sensor information in the form of a link. As discussed above, the link can be a hyperlink specifying a network resource (e.g., a website and/or database of external sources 112) and path storing one or more of the sensor information.
In operation 612, the portable computing device 104 can transmit a third communication to the network resource, via the network 114, requesting the sensor information corresponding to the link. As an example, an operator can select the link received in the second communication using the portable computing device 104. In another embodiment, the portable computing device 104 can detect the link within the second communication and automatically transmit the third communication to the network resource without operator intervention.
In operation 614, the portable computing device 104 can receive a fourth communication containing the sensor information requested in operation 612 from the network resource via the network 114.
In operation 616, any of the requested sensor information contained within the response from the network resource can be displayed and/or optionally stored, by the portable computing device 104. In an embodiment, if none of the requested sensor information is stored by the RF tag 110, the method can subsequently return to operation 602, allowing an operator to select sensor information to be retrieved from the RF tag 110. By default, if none of requested sensor information is stored by the RF tag 110, the second communication can include a link (e.g., a hyperlink) containing a unique identifier of the sensor 106. An operator can subsequently select the link using the portable computing device 104, to retrieve any sensor information associated with the sensor 106 from the network resource, as discussed above.
In operation 702, the portable computing device 104 can send a request for updated sensor information to the network resource. As an example, transmission of the request can be performed in response to operator selections input using of the portable computing device 104. The request can include a unique identifier for the sensor 106, received by the portable computing device 104 prior to the transmission in operation 702. In certain embodiments, the portable computing device 104 can receive the unique identifier from the RF tag 110 according to the method 600, as discussed above.
In operation 704, a response to the request for updated sensor information can be received by the portable computing device 104 from the network resource. As an example, the response can contain one or more updated sensor information corresponding to the requested updated sensor information.
In operation 706, following receipt of the response, the portable computing device 104 can transmit the received updated sensor information to the RF tag 110 for storage.
Exemplary technical effects of the methods, systems, and devices described herein include, by way of non-limiting example, near field communication suitable for retrieval and storage of sensor information from testing devices including sensors such as ultrasonic probes.
The subject matter described herein can be implemented in digital electronic circuitry, or in computer software, firmware, or hardware, including the structural means disclosed in this specification and structural equivalents thereof, or in combinations of them. The subject matter described herein can be implemented as one or more computer program products, such as one or more computer programs tangibly embodied in an information carrier (e.g., in a machine readable storage device), or embodied in a propagated signal, for execution by, or to control the operation of, data processing system (e.g., a programmable processor, a computer, or multiple computers). A computer program (also known as a program, software, software application, or code) can be written in any form of programming language, including compiled or interpreted languages, and it can be deployed in any form, including as a stand-alone program or as a module, component, subroutine, or other unit suitable for use in a computing environment. A computer program does not necessarily correspond to a file. A program can be stored in a portion of a file that holds other programs or data, in a single file dedicated to the program in question, or in multiple coordinated files (e.g., files that store one or more modules, sub programs, or portions of code). A computer program can be deployed to be executed on one computer or on multiple computers at one site or distributed across multiple sites and interconnected by a communication network.
The processes and logic flows described in this specification, including the method steps of the subject matter described herein, can be performed by one or more programmable processors executing one or more computer programs to perform functions of the subject matter described herein by operating on input data and generating output. The processes and logic flows can also be performed by, and system of the subject matter described herein can be implemented as, special purpose logic circuitry, e.g., an FPGA (field programmable gate array) or an ASIC (application specific integrated circuit).
Processors suitable for the execution of a computer program include, by way of example, both general and special purpose microprocessors, and any one or more processor of any kind of digital computer. Generally, a processor will receive instructions and data from a read only memory or a random access memory or both. The essential elements of a computer are a processor for executing instructions and one or more memory devices for storing instructions and data. Generally, a computer will also include, or be operatively coupled to receive data from or transfer data to, or both, one or more mass storage devices for storing data, e.g., magnetic, magneto optical disks, or optical disks. Information carriers suitable for embodying computer program instructions and data include all forms of non-volatile memory, including by way of example semiconductor memory devices, (e.g., EPROM, EEPROM, and flash memory devices); magnetic disks, (e.g., internal hard disks or removable disks); magneto optical disks; and optical disks (e.g., CD and DVD disks). The processor and the memory can be supplemented by, or incorporated in, special purpose logic circuitry.
To provide for interaction with a user, the subject matter described herein can be implemented on a computer having a display device, e.g., a CRT (cathode ray tube) or LCD (liquid crystal display) monitor, for displaying information to the user and a keyboard and a pointing device, (e.g., a mouse or a trackball), by which the user can provide input to the computer. Other kinds of devices can be used to provide for interaction with a user as well. For example, feedback provided to the user can be any form of sensory feedback, (e.g., visual feedback, auditory feedback, or tactile feedback), and input from the user can be received in any form, including acoustic, speech, or tactile input.
The techniques described herein can be implemented using one or more modules. As used herein, the term “module” refers to computing software, firmware, hardware, and/or various combinations thereof. At a minimum, however, modules are not to be interpreted as software that is not implemented on hardware, firmware, or recorded on a non-transitory processor readable recordable storage medium (i.e., modules are not software per se). Indeed “module” is to be interpreted to always include at least some physical, non-transitory hardware such as a part of a processor or computer. Two different modules can share the same physical hardware (e.g., two different modules can use the same processor and network interface). The modules described herein can be combined, integrated, separated, and/or duplicated to support various applications. Also, a function described herein as being performed at a particular module can be performed at one or more other modules and/or by one or more other devices instead of or in addition to the function performed at the particular module. Further, the modules can be implemented across multiple devices and/or other components local or remote to one another. Additionally, the modules can be moved from one device and added to another device, and/or can be included in both devices.
The subject matter described herein can be implemented in a computing system that includes a back end component (e.g., a data server), a middleware component (e.g., an application server), or a front end component (e.g., a client computer having a graphical user interface or a web browser through which a user can interact with an implementation of the subject matter described herein), or any combination of such back end, middleware, and front end components. The components of the system can be interconnected by any form or medium of digital data communication, e.g., a communication network. Examples of communication networks include a local area network (“LAN”) and a wide area network (“WAN”), e.g., the Internet.
Approximating language, as used herein throughout the specification and claims, may be applied to modify any quantitative representation that could permissibly vary without resulting in a change in the basic function to which it is related. Accordingly, a value modified by a term or terms, such as “about” and “substantially,” are not to be limited to the precise value specified. In at least some instances, the approximating language may correspond to the precision of an instrument for measuring the value. Here and throughout the specification and claims, range limitations may be combined and/or interchanged, such ranges are identified and include all the sub-ranges contained therein unless context or language indicates otherwise.
One skilled in the art will appreciate further features and advantages of the invention based on the above-described embodiments. Accordingly, the present application is not to be limited by what has been particularly shown and described, except as indicated by the appended claims. All publications and references cited herein are expressly incorporated by reference in their entirety.
Number | Name | Date | Kind |
---|---|---|---|
8874383 | Gambier et al. | Oct 2014 | B2 |
20080116908 | Potyrailo | May 2008 | A1 |
20090189738 | Hermle | Jul 2009 | A1 |
20140107487 | Kim et al. | Apr 2014 | A1 |
20140303755 | Landgraf et al. | Oct 2014 | A1 |
20150377214 | Du Plessis | Dec 2015 | A1 |
20160220325 | Jeon et al. | Aug 2016 | A1 |
20160379426 | Tholen | Dec 2016 | A1 |
20170105703 | Han | Apr 2017 | A1 |
Number | Date | Country |
---|---|---|
2011132122 | Oct 2011 | WO |
2016070019 | May 2016 | WO |
Entry |
---|
International Search Report and Written Opinion issued in connection with corresponding PCT Application No. PCT/US2018/026452 dated Jul. 26, 2018. |
Hepeng, Dai, and Su Donglin, “Indoor location system using RFID and ultrasonic sensors”. In 2008 8th International Symposium on Antennas, Propagation and EM Theory, Nov. 2-5, 2008. |
Number | Date | Country | |
---|---|---|---|
20180292359 A1 | Oct 2018 | US |